Mittens is an 18-month-old bonded female gray tabby with her brother, Buttons. Their owner died, leaving them abandoned in a house by themselves for 6 weeks. They are sweet, gentle, and, after a short period of adjustment, have proven to be very loveable cats. Mittens is short-haired and has a heart-melting purr and lets you pet her tummy once she's settled in. Buttons is medium-haired, has a quieter purr, and loves rubbing against your leg. They had a vet appointment on December 11, 2025, and got a clean bill of health. Mittens weighs 7 lb 6 oz. Buttons weighs 9# 6 oz. They will do well in a home where owners are patient with them as they adjust. They live near Newport, Oregon
